      Wales

      A Very Peculiar History

      • 192 pages
      • 7 hours of reading

      Exploring the quirky and unusual facets of Wales, this book traces the country's history from Roman times to the mining era. It highlights unique elements like Welsh rarebit and the tongue-twisting name of Llanfairpwllgwyngyll. With engaging comic-style illustrations and packed with intriguing facts, it offers a captivating look at Wales' heritage, filled with triumphs and challenges. A glossary, timeline, and index enhance its appeal, making it an ideal gift for readers of all ages.

      The Age of Gladiators

      Savagery and Spectacle in Ancient Rome

      • 240 pages
      • 9 hours of reading
      3.5(14)Add rating

      Exploring the brutal spectacles of Ancient Rome, this book delves into the origins and evolution of gladiatorial combats and chariot races, highlighting their role in society as both entertainment and political tools. It examines the paradox of wealth spent on public amusements amidst widespread poverty and questions the nature of Roman citizenship and democracy. Through vivid descriptions and historical insights, the narrative uncovers how these savage events shaped public life and political dynamics in a city known for its contrasts of bloodshed and revelry.
